Manufacturing Engineer

Missouri, St louis, 63011 St louis USA

Job Description

  • Designmanufacturing processes, procedures and production layouts, equipment installation, processing, machining and material handling.
  • Analyzeinformation, generate alternatives, and commit to solutions that ensure the efficient use of resources.
  • Implementimprovements by prioritizing and assigning tasks, resources and accountabilities to ensure objectives are met within the required time and budget.
  • Design arrangement of machines within plant facilities to ensure most efficient and productive layout.
  • Ensure that the facility operates within all applicable legal, safety, and environmental requirements.
  • Maintaincapital assets in premium condition while creating a showplace environment throughout the facility.
  • Maintainbuilding and grounds and lead facility conservation projects through team efforts or through contractors, including utility services, waste management and disposal, and operating systems.
  • Modify products and processes to achieve an environmentally friendly workplace and eliminate any health or hygiene hazards with the facilities.
  • Performvarious administrative responsibilities such as timely reporting, meetings, project management, developing safe work methods, interfacing with OSHA, EPA, emergency response teams, risk management and loss protection.
  • Collaboratewith Engineering regarding product design concepts and specification requirements to best utilize equipment and manufacturing techniques.
  • Identify, leadand developtalent in order to maximize individual, team and organizational effectiveness in meeting company goals.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or Degree in mechanical or manufacturing engineering discipline with 3-5 years experience in high-volume manufacturing environment.
  • Increasing level of responsibilities in managing matters and resolving issues related to building and grounds maintenance, equipment and tooling design and modification, production equipment acquisition, installation and maintenance, project management and supervision.
  • Knowledge and application of design, engineering and technology, computers and electronics, technology design, and problem solving.
  • Proficiency in AutoCAD and /or SolidWorks CADD software.
  • Experience with Value Stream Mapping, Six Sigma Tools, Lean Manufacturing, Automation, and Capital Project is a plus.
